They are the reason that the modern oils have moved away from the higher concentrations of the 'heavy metal' zinc.  That and newer formulations and design of engine parts and metals.  Another reason is that the GM dealership no longer rebuild engines,  it is just not cost effective.  The engines that the dealerships use to replace under warranty are not new but re-manufactured by 'others'.  There are probably other reasons GM has discontinued EOS and are purely financial.
   
  I picked up a couple of pints from the local dealership the other day to use during the engine rebuild this fall/winter.  They have a couple more pints which I will get next Tuesday.  I noticed that the instructions say to use only during rebuild and not as an oil additive.  They do not list the contents ie. concentration of 'zinc'.
